Teresa Wilson

Shortlisted for NEO Artprize 2019

Teresa Wilson is a visual artist best known for her uncanny human sculpture, working with ideas of the uncanny and the abject.  She has evolved a body of work that includes discrete works of doll sculpture and dramatic room-sized immersive installations.

Wilson has had several solo shows including an online solo show with Laura I. Gallery, London in  2021; Bankley Gallery, Manchester; Window Gallery, Salford University; Stockport Memorial Art Gallery;  Arena Gallery, Liverpool and Chapman Gallery, Salford. 

She has featured in many group shows, of which a recent selection are Manchester Open 2022; AIR Gallery, Altrincham; Manchester City Art Gallery; Tate Gallery, Liverpool and Barnaby Festival.  Wilson was shortlisted for the NEO ArtPrize 2019 and has exhibited with the Society of Women Artists (SWA) at the Mall Galleries, London.

Residencies and commissions include a research project residency at the Babyan CultureHouse, Urgup, Turkey and  Manchester Triennial.  Recently, she joined the collaborative ‘Uncanny Stitch’ in an installation for Buxton Fringe Festival 2022.

Teresa Wilson trained at University of Salford (BA Visual Arts) and also has studied at The University of Manchester (BA History of Art).  She is currently studying for an MA in Contemporary Fine Art at the University of Salford.
